Kamera Klutz and the Gray Card
The light gray card was given to us by the photography instructor. As you can see, it is lighter than the standaard 18% gray in the darker card. More important, is that the light card is also somewhat opaque and lightens even more in the bright sun. When used to meter outdoor, the pictures turned out consistently underexposed.

Kamera Klutz: Kolor and Kelvin
Lights have different colors depending on the temperature of the light. Within a given day, the lighting color changes.
Indoor lights have different colors as well: fluorescent and incandescent.
White balance is adjusted to accommodate the differences in lighting and color.

Kamera Klutz: Sunny 16
When making photos outdoors, try the sunny 16 rule rather than the grey card.
f 16 ISO 100 shutter speed 100
f 16 ISO 200 shutter speed 200
Bracket using the sunny 16 rule as the initial setting.

Kamera Klutz; Indoor Settings
To keep the color pure and bright; settings must be adjusted.
ISO 400
white balance-to match the light source-tungsten
Two different studio lights were used. The halogen lights created the warmer colore and the LED lights produced the cooler colors.
